Atty. Jeffrey Shear
Jeff Shear is a member of the firm's Real Estate Practice Group, where he represents a wide variety of stakeholders, ranging from developers and lenders to institutional investors regarding real estate acquisitions, dispositions, financing and lending. For developer representation, Jeff handles all aspects of commercial and residential real estate projects, including acquisitions, zoning and permitting, financing, and disposition.

About
- Jeff Shear is a member of the firm's Real Estate Practice Group, where he represents a wide variety of stakeholders, ranging from developers and lenders to institutional investors regarding real estate acquisitions, dispositions, financing and lending
- For developer representation, Jeff handles all aspects of commercial and residential real estate projects, including acquisitions, zoning and permitting, financing, and disposition
- He also represents buyers and sellers in commercial real estate transactions of office buildings, multi-family developments, and shopping centers and is an authorized agent of multiple national title insurance companies
- Additionally, he frequently represents landlords and tenants in commercial office and retail lease negotiations
